Overview

The Rabbit hemorrhagic disease virus capsid protein VP1, also widely known as VP60, is the primary structural protein of the RHDV virion, a highly contagious calicivirus affecting lagomorphs [1, 5]. It self-assembles into an icosahedral shell composed of 180 subunits that protects the viral genome and facilitates host cell entry [15, 17]. The protein features a conserved shell (S) domain and a variable protruding (P) domain, with the P2 subdomain serving as the site for binding host histo-blood group antigens (HBGAs) that act as attachment factors [4, 6]. As the major surface-exposed antigen, VP1 is the principal target for neutralizing antibodies, making it the essential component of both traditional inactivated vaccines and modern recombinant virus-like particle (VLP) vaccines [5, 13]. Mutations within the P2 subdomain drive the emergence of new antigenic variants, such as RHDV2 (GI.2), which can evade immunity generated against older strains [1, 14]. Consequently, VP1 is the primary focus for diagnostic assays and the development of multivalent vaccines to control outbreaks in domestic and wild rabbit populations [9, 12].

Mechanism of action

Induction of neutralizing antibodies that bind to the VP1 protein, sterically blocking the virus from attaching to host histo-blood group antigens (HBGAs) and preventing viral entry into host cells [4, 13].
